Why This is an Exciting Role:

As a Systems Engineer - Senior Level at Boeing Intelligence & Analytics (BI&A), you will be responsible for:
  • Innovating RF signal processing applications
  • Facilitating the integration of new and legacy software across a variety of hardware form factors
  • Implementing comprehensive Service-Oriented Architecture (SOA) solutions
  • Establishing a process to formally and proactively control and manage changes to requirements, consider impacts prior to commitment to change, gain stakeholder buy-in, eliminate ambiguity, ensure traceability to source requirements, and track and settle open actions
  • Developing scenarios (threads) and an Operational Concept describing the interactions between the system, the user, and the environment, that satisfy operational, support, maintenance, and disposal needs
  • Implementing operational, technical standards, and system and services views for architectures using applicable Department of Defense Architecture Framework (DoDAF) standards
  • Conducting quantitative analysis in non-functional system performance areas like Reliability, Maintainability, Vulnerability, Survivability, Producibility, etc.
  • Assessing each risk to the program and determine the probability of occurrence and quantified consequence of failure in accordance with an approved risk management plan
  • Planning the verification efforts of new and unproven designs early in the development life cycle to ensure compliance with established requirements
  • Capturing all interface designs in a common interface control format, and store interface data in a commonly accessible repository
  • Providing technical direction for the development, engineering, interfacing, integration, and testing of specific components of complex hardware/software systems
  • Establishing and following a formal procedure for coordinating system integration activities among multiple teams, ensuring complete coverage of all interfaces
  • Preparing timeline analysis diagrams illustrating the flow of time-dependent functions
  • Reviewing and/or approving system engineering documentation to ensure that processes and specifications meet system needs and are accurate, comprehensive, and complete
  • Supporting the planning and test analysis of the DoD Certification/Accreditation Process (as well as other Government Certification and Accreditation (C&A) processes)
  • Supporting the development and review of Joint Capability Integration Development System (JCIDS) documents (i.e., Initial Capability Document, Capabilities Description Document, IA Strategy)
  • Managing and ensuring the technical integrity of the system baseline over time, continually updating it as various changes are imposed on the system during the lifecycle from development through deployment and operations & maintenance in conjunction with system stakeholders
